Project MR6

Heads-off Gaskets On
With the heads gone, we got a look at the stock head gaskets. These composition gaskets are fine for a stock powerplant, but they can easily fail in high-boost applications if there's even a hint of detonation. We sent them to Clark Copper Head Gaskets to duplicate them in copper. Note the OE flat-top 10.4:1 pistons with intake valve reliefs almost ready for the scrap heap: We already had a set of Wiseco forgings one size over with extra-thick crowns capable of machining for reduced compression if required. Toyota permits one size overboring.
